Output ec2ae2005abc9f8c67421067b28d374abd292b0703d628f8cf247af81007d1b3:3

value
9658399
script pubkey
OP_0 OP_PUSHBYTES_20 8f587055b30b16b404e91fa7508b87ac0c2c2f0b
address
bc1q3av8q4dnpvttgp8fr7n4pzu84sxzctctyga0gk
transaction
ec2ae2005abc9f8c67421067b28d374abd292b0703d628f8cf247af81007d1b3
spent
true